Factors to consider when choosing a Hotel Management College in West Bengal

Curriculum & Industry Orientation

A Hospital Management college should have strong kitchen, bakery & hospitality labs for better class learning. Check if the syllabus is up to date with practical exposure and real internships supported by the college.

Faculty Experiences & Connections

A Hospital Management college must have teachers wth industry background to bring in the practical knowledge even in a theory class. Also, check if the college brings  guest lectures and training from professionals 

Placement & Internship Support

Look for a college that provides internship support, check verified data, such as placement percentage, well-known recruiters like Taj, Oberoi, Marriott, and details of average and highest salary packages obtained by students of a Hotel Management college. 

Affiliation & Recognition (Essential, Not Optional)

Check whether the college offers a UGC-recognised degree and is affiliated with a valid university, as it will make sure your degree is accepted globally. Also, choosing an institution that is NAAC-accredited is an added advantage as it reflects quality education, infrastructure, and overall credibility.

Cost vs. Value


A good Hotel Management college has a clear and transparent fee structure, with no hidden charges. Also, check if the college has any scholarship schemes or educational loan support to aid students financially. More importantly, compare the cost of the course with what you can realistically expect in terms of skills, internships, placements, and career growth.

Alumni Network & Brand Partnerships

Check if the college has strong alumni network which often brings better guidance, mentoring and most importantly job referrals. Also, brand partnerships are key for giving students of the college better internship opportunities and smoother placement support.

Guru Nanak Institute of Hotel Management, Kolkata

Guru Nanak Institute of Hotel Management

This institute is located in Sodepur, North Kolkata, and it offers a lively campus environment with a focus on practical learning. 

The college has well-equipped kitchen and bakery labs, housekeeping labs, and training restaurants that help students learn through hands-on experience. 

Students benefit from industry internships in hotels, resorts, and cruise lines, and the institute actively supports placements in both domestic and international hospitality brands. 

Campus life is engaging, with events, food festivals, and skill-based workshops that build confidence and communication skills.

IIAS, Siliguri

This college is located in Dagapur and provides a calm yet career-focused campus environment. 

The institute offers hotel management programs with emphasis on hospitality operations, service skills, and personality development. 

Students gain exposure through internships in hotels across North Bengal, Sikkim, and metro cities. 

The location itself adds value, as students experience tourism-driven hospitality in hill stations and travel hubs. 

Campus life is simple, student-friendly, and suitable for those looking for focused learning away from metro distractions.

NSHM Institute of Hotel & Tourism Management, Kolkata

NSHM Knowledge Campus

This college is located in Tollygunge, South Kolkata, and is part of a large educational group known for industry-oriented programs. 

The institute offers strong exposure in hotel management, tourism, and travel studies, supported by modern labs and training facilities. 

Students participate in live projects, internships, and international training opportunities. Placement support is structured, with opportunities in hotels, travel companies, airlines, and event management firms.

Campus life is vibrant, with regular events, industry interactions, and student clubs. 

👉  See how internship opportunities support real-world hospitality experience

DSMS College, Durgapur

This college is located in Durgapur, and it offers hotel management programs focused on skill development and employability. 

The campus provides basic hospitality labs and a supportive learning environment. 

Students gain internship exposure through tie-ups with hotels and service organizations, especially in eastern India. 

Campus life is community-driven, with a focus on discipline, training, and career readiness.

Aryabhatta Institute of Engineering & Management (AIEMD), Durgapur

AIEMD

This institute is located in Durgapur and is primarily known for engineering and management education, with hospitality programs offered as part of its management studies. 

The institute emphasizes managerial skills along with hospitality fundamentals, making it suitable for students interested in hotel administration roles. 

Campus life includes seminars, cultural programs, and skill-development activities. 

Internship and placement support focuses on management-level hospitality roles rather than core hotel operations.

👉  Explore salary trends in hospitality management before choosing a course

Bengal Institute of Technology and Management (BITM), Santiniketan

This college is located near Santiniketan and offers hotel management programs in a calm campus environment ideal for focused learning. 

Students receive practical exposure through hospitality labs, internships, and industry training. 

Campus life blends academics with cultural activities, helping students develop soft skills and professionalism.

FAQs:

1. What qualifications are required to join a hotel management college after 12th?

ANS:- Most hotel management colleges require candidates to have passed Class 12 from a recognized board. Some institutes may also conduct entrance tests or personal interviews to assess communication skills and aptitude.

2. What is the average salary after completing hotel management in West Bengal?

ANS:- Fresh graduates from hotel management colleges typically earn between ₹2.5–4.5 LPA initially. Salaries increase significantly with experience, brand exposure, and international placements.

3. Do hotel management colleges in West Bengal provide internships?

ANS:- Yes, reputed hotel management colleges in West Bengal provide mandatory internships with leading hotel chains like Taj, ITC, Oberoi, Marriott, and regional luxury resorts, which play a key role in placements.

4. Is a government hotel management college better than a private one?

ANS:- Government colleges like IHM Kolkata offer strong brand value and affordable fees, while private colleges often provide better infrastructure, personalized training, and holistic skill development. The best choice depends on your learning needs and career goals.

5. Can I work abroad after completing hotel management from West Bengal?

ANS:- Yes, many hotel management colleges in West Bengal have international internship tie-ups and global placement opportunities in hotels, airlines, cruise lines, and luxury hospitality brands.

6. Which is the best hotel management college in West Bengal after 12th?

ANS:- The best hotel management college in West Bengal depends on your budget, location preference, and career goals. Institutes like IHM Kolkata, Inspiria Knowledge Campus, IIHM Kolkata, and Guru Nanak Institute are among the top choices for quality education, internships, and placements.
